Safety test
46. Electrical safety test
According to the German law of safe machine operation of 24th June 1986, the VDE-regulations are
regarded as the official rules in electronics and are the basis for the regulations for testing electrical
safety of technical devices.
The required electrical tests are established in the regulations for repair, modification and testing of used
electrical appliances (VDE 0701 issue 10.86) par. 4.
We are obliged to perform a test in accordance with VDE 0701 on every electrical appliance after
repair.
In European foreign countries, there are similar regulations in force which are largely identical with the
requirements of the VDE 0701.
47. Electrical safety test with ABB Metrawatt M 5013
I Mains voltage test: Volt = V
●
For all following tests insert plug of ABB Metrawatt M 5013 in the grounded mains socket (fig. 115).
●
Set knob for measuring range at "250 V" (fig. 115). If there is mains voltage, the LCD shows the
respective value (230 V +/- 10%).
●
Touch contact field, which is located a bit to the right just below the knob for the measuring range, with
your finger, thus checking the ground lead of the mains. Signal lamp "PE" just above the contact field
will light up only in case the ground lead is out of order.
●
Insert plug of sewing machine into the mains socket of ABB Metrawatt M 5013.
●
Run the machine.
●
Meter reading: 230 V +/- 10%
●
Measuring appliance M 5013 can only be used with mains voltages from 207 V to 253 V
(230 V +/- 10%).
II Appliance current test: Ampere = A
●
Plug of sewing machine remains in mains socket.
●
Set knob for the measuring range at 16 A (fig. 116).
●
Run the machine.
●
Meter reading: 0.5 A maximum.
III Insulation resistance: M Ohm = M
●
Insert plug of sewing machine in tester socket.
●
Use clamp to attach test lead of testing appliance M 5013 to presser bar.
●
Set knob for measuring range at "20 M Ohm" (fig. 117).
●
Meter reading: minimum 2 M Ohm
●
With meter readings higher than 20 M Ohm, appliance M 5013 displays the figure 1! In these cases,
the remark "Insulation resistance higher than 20 M Ohm" must be recorded in the testing certificate.
